Surah Al-Baqarah: The Heifer

Revealed at Madinah


2:41
And believe in that which I have revealed confirming which is with you, and do not become the first to disbelieve in it, and do not exchange My Messages for a meager price; and Me, Me alone then should you revere.



2:42
And do not clothe the Truth with falsehood, nor conceal the Truth, while you were knowing.


2:43
And establish the Salat, and give the Zakat, and bow down with the bowers down.


2:44
Do you command mankind for piety while you yourselves forget, and yet you read the scripture? Don’t you then apply sense?


2:45
And you seek the help with perseverance and Salat. And that indeed is a hard thing except for the humble ones,—


2:46
who think that they are indeed going to meet their Rabb, and that they are certainly returning towards Him.


2:47
O Children of Israil! remember My favor which I bestowed upon you, and that I distinguished you above the nations.


2:48
And guard yourselves against a Day— no soul will avail from another soul aught, nor will any intercession be accepted on its behalf, nor will any compensation be taken from it, nor will they be helped.


2:49
And remember: We rescued you from the people of Fir‘awn, they afflicted you with terrible torment, they slaughtered your sons and let your females live. And in this there was a great trial from your Rabb.


2:50
And remember, We parted the Sea for you, thus We rescued you, and We drowned the people of Fir‘awn while you were looking on.


2:51
And behold! We made an appointment of forty nights with Musa, then you took the calf in his absence, and you were unjust.


2:52
Yet, even after that, We did forgive you, that perhaps you might give thanks.


2:53
And remember,— We gave Musa the scripture, and the Discrimination, that you may follow guidance.


2:54
And behold! Musa said to his people: “O my people! you have indeed wronged your own selves by your taking the calf; so turn to your Creator, and mortify your souls. This is better for you in the sight of your Creator.” Therefore He turned towards you. Surely He, He is the Oft-returning, the most Rewarding.


2:55
And remember,— you said: “O Musa! We shall not believe in you until we see Allah manifestly.” Then the thunderbolt overtook you while you looked on..


2:56
Then We raised you up after your stupor that perhaps you might give thanks.


2:57
And We caused the clouds to overshadow you, and We sent down upon you the manna and the quails: “Eat of the good things wherewith We have provided you.” And they did not harm Us, but they rather were doing harm to themselves


2:58
And behold! We said: “Enter this township and eat from it as-and-when you wish— plentifully; but enter the gate submissively; and say: ‘Hittatun’, We may forgive you your wrongs; and We shall immediately increase to the doors of good.”


2:59
But those who were unjust changed this saying, different from what had been said to them; so We sent down upon those who did wrong a pestilence from above, because they had been transgressing.


2:60
And remember,— Musa sought water for his people, so We said: “Strike with your staff the Rock.” So there gushed forth from it twelve springs. Every tribe just knew their drinking places. “Eat and drink out of the provisions of Allah, and do not act corruptly in the earth— being mischief-makers.”
